spooge@sizone.jaywon.pci.on.ca (Hades Or Cyberpolka) writes:
>Will Linux support the Sony 535 CDRom? I am thinking of buying one used,
>but dont want to since I will be running linux very soon.
>It IS a SCSI drive, BUT, the controller will ONLY control the CDRom, and
>the CDROM will only be controlled by that controller. (Proprietary
>SCSI?)

It is _not_ a SCSI drive. The CDU-535 is a Sony-BUS drive that only
works with Sony-BUS interface boards. I have one and it is a good
CD-ROM drive. The Sony CDU-541 is a similar drive with
a SCSI interface.
